| Introduction | Andy Miller has won awards and commendations for his writing over a 25-year period. His poetry has been published in UK national magazines such as Iota, Staple, Envoi and Orbis and he was judged winner of the 2011 Yeovil Literary Prize for Poetry. In addition he has published articles and essays in 'Climber', 'On The Edge' and 'She Magazine' and a chapter in the 1999 US book, 'Encounters with Bob Dylan'. Andy is also currently completing his first novel which examines the respective roles of fiction and autobiography in exploring family secrets. In his career as a practitioner psychologist and a special professor of educational psychology he published over 50 peer-refereed journal articles and book chapters and 10 authored and edited books. He is a member of Nottingham Writers Studio and lives with his wife in Wirksworth, Derbyshire on the edge of the English Peak District. |
